Wilson Hall and Pinewood Prep are an even 5-5 against one another since October of 2015, but not for long. The Barons will face off against the Panthers at 7:30 p.m. on Saturday. Both squads will be entering this one on the heels of a big victory.
Wilson Hall is on a roll after a high-stakes playoff matchup on Friday. They were the clear victors by a 50-29 margin over Hilton Head Christian Academy. Winning may never get old, but the Barons sure are getting used to it with their eighth in a row.
Meanwhile, everything came up roses for Pinewood Prep against Florence Christian on Friday as the squad secured a 45-6 victory.
Pinewood Prep's win came from a few key players Wilson Hall will need to keep an eye on. One of the most notable was Grayson Salego, who rushed for 131 yards and a pair of TDs on only 11 carries. That's the most rushing yards he has posted since back in August. Lavoris Lucas was another key player, gaining 82 total yards and three touchdowns.
Special teams was a major factor in the game for Pinewood Prep, racking up 15 points in total. The biggest highlight from special teams (and perhaps the team as a whole) came courtesy of Lucas, who ran a kickoff back for a touchdown.
Pinewood Prep's win bumped their record up to 9-3. As for Wilson Hall, their victory bumped their record up to 11-1.
Wilson Hall was able to grind out a solid win over Pinewood Prep in their previous matchup back in October, winning 28-21.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Barons since the team won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
